Can a car loan be paid off early?

One way to pay off your car loan early is to make one lump payment. Contact your lender to find out your car loan payoff amount and ask how to submit it. The payoff amount includes your loan balance and any interest or fees you owe. You can also pay more than the minimum amount due each month.24 nov. 2020

Do extra car payments go to principal?

By the end, almost all of your payment goes toward paying principal. For example, imagine you had a $500 car payment for 60 months at 2.5% interest. If you make extra, principal-only payments, you can shorten the length of the loan while decreasing the total amount of interest you’ll pay over the life of the loan.10 jan. 2021

Does your car payment go down if you pay extra?

Have some extra cash and wondering ‘will my car payment go down if I pay extra?’ You can always make a higher payment and reduce your loan balance. However, if you make an extra payment, your car payment will not go down. The auto loan company instead reduces your loan balance and shortens the term of your loan.

How do you check if a car loan is paid off?

Go to your state DMV site and see if they have a title checker feature. It varies by state but most have this feature. It allows you to put in the VIN number of any vehicles you are considering and it will pull up the title information on record. You should be able to determine if the car has a lien against it.26 avr. 2016

What happens if I pay half my car loan?

1. Pay half your monthly payment every two weeks. … That adds up to 13 full payments a year, rather than 12. If you have a 60-month, $10,000 loan, you’ll save only about $35 in interest, but you’ll repay the loan in 54 months rather than 60.

What’s the difference between late and partial payments? First things first: a late payment is when you make a payment after the due date; a partial payment is when you pay only part of the bill. … If you ever see yourself falling short or behind on payments, contact the lender proactively to try to work out a solution.19 déc. 2019

Is it smart to pay off a car early?

Paying off your car loan early frees up a good chunk of extra cash to keep in your pocket. … If your car loan’s rate is low compared to other types of debt, like credit cards, consider paying off the debt with the highest interest rate first. That way you save more on total interest owed.28 mai 2021
